For many low-carb dieters, keto is often (inaccurately!) synonymous with high-protein, meaty meals.

If you’ve made the choice to skip out on the bacon, you may be wondering if you’ve found yourself in a culinary pickle!

Since so many keto recipes call for chicken, pork or beef, what’s a dedicated vegetarian to do?

Contrary to popular belief, the most important ingredient for ketogenic diets is actually the consumption of healthy fats. Giving up meat doesn’t have to mean giving up great flavor!

Halloumi is an under-appreciated Greek cheese that just refuses to melt. For this reason, it’s known as the “grilling cheese,” and makes a delicious substitute for meat on the griddle or barbecue. Halloumi is tender and flavorful, complemented perfectly by fresh cucumber, tomatoes, and arugula.

Is popcorn ok for keto? ›

Net carbs are calculated by taking the total grams of carbohydrate in a food and subtracting the amount of fiber. In this case, popcorn contains 6 grams of carbs per 1 cup serving and 1.2 grams of fiber, bringing the net carbs per serving to 4.8 grams. Yes friends, popcorn is indeed a keto food.

Is cottage cheese keto? ›

Cottage cheese, like ricotta, is not as keto-friendly, and you should limit the amount you eat if you're on a strict keto diet, says Weiss. While cottage cheese is known for its high protein content, it also contains a relatively high amount of carbs and not that much fat, making it a less-than-ideal choice for keto.

Are cucumbers keto? ›

Cucumber is another popular salad vegetable. It contains many essential nutrients, including vitamin K. Cucumber is also suitable for the keto diet, as its carb content is just 3.63 g per 100 g. To make the carb content lower, a person can peel the cucumber before eating it.

Is hummus keto? ›

Hummus can definitely be part of your keto diet, but just one or two servings can quickly expend a significant portion of your daily carb allotment. If you do eat hummus, you'll want to limit yourself to a small amount — perhaps just 2–4 tablespoons (30–60 grams), which provide 4–8 grams of net carbs.
